    I have just spent the morning building the Sopwith Triplane, I won't win any prizes for my modelling but it has turned out fine and with some paint will be a welcome addition of my collection. I used the 'jig' but found it better to build it upside down, top wing and centre wings first, then simply sat them on the lower one for completion.
